Designed by Calvi Brambilla
Round coffee table in aluminum, available in different colours. Easy to stack for transport or storage. Ideal as a side table for sun loungers or beds by the pool.
Finishes:
Stackable, structure in aluminium powder coated white, silk grey or grey
Dimensions:
DIA450 x H400 mm

Armchair with hand-weaving in synthetic fiber and varnished metal structure. The high back of the Tibidabo chair allows full support of the back for ultimate relaxation directly in the garden of your own home.
The round lines of this table, combined with its aluminum and hand-woven synthetic fiber frame, make this product ideal for a drink with friends or outdoor afternoons.
The nest of the TIBIDABO collection in characterized by a supporting structure in powder coated steel tube covered by a hand-woven synthetic fiber rope: its sophisticated design makes it suitable for the furnishing of a private house or a hotel terrace.
Versatile outdoor chair with powder coated aluminum structure, featuring numerous combinations of different materials and fabrics for seat, backrest and legs. This outdoor chair’s backrest can be made of hand-woven synthetic fiber cord, Textilene or an outdoor waterproof fabric, to choose from the wide range of Varaschin. Sunlounger with aluminum frame, seat and backrest in perforated batyline fabric designed with the option of two different seating style.
Kabu, curve in Japanese. With this name, I stress the conceptual process of the collection design. The light structure is dressed up with a technical fabric that becomes skin and wrap. The curvature generated as a result of the fabric tension on the structure highlights the desire for a lightweight, upholstered frame.
